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/3] iio: adc: ad7616: Add support for AD7616 ADC

On Tue, 2 Apr 2019 16:18:40 +0300
Beniamin Bia <beniamin.bia@...log.com> wrote:

> The AD7616 is a 12-bit ADC with 16 channels.
> 
> The AD7616 can be configured to work in hardware mode by controlling it via
> gpio pins and read data via spi. No support for software mode yet, but it
> is a work in progress.
> 
> This device requires a reset in order to update oversampling, so chip info
> has got a new attribute to mark this.
> 
> The current assumption that this driver makes for AD7616, is that it's
> working in Hardware Mode with Serial, Burst and Sequencer modes activated.
> To activate them, following pins must be pulled high:
> 	-SER/PAR
> 	-SEQEN
> And following must be pulled low:
> 	-WR/BURST
> 	-DB4/SEQEN

Looks good to me. One thing to look at in future is making it completely
clear what the various people in the signed-off-by list did.  It may
be that you would ideally have a co-authored-by tag in here?  The
usecases for that have only be clarified very recently so I won't
worry too much this time.

Applied to the togreg branch of iio.git and pushed out as testing for
the autobuilders to play with it.
